Application Notes
-
Approved: IF (2 - 3 μg/mL), WB (1 - 3 μg/mL)
Usage: Suitable for use in Immunofluorescence and Western Blot. Immunofluorescence: 2-3 μg/mL, Note: For optimal results in immunofluorescence assays, cells should be fixed in 4 % paraformaldehyde/0.5 % Triton X-100/PBS for 10 minutes, permeabilized with 0.5 % Triton X-100/PBS for 5 minutes, and blocked with 5 % BSA/PBS for 30 minutes. Western Blot: 1-3 μg/mL, Single band at ~200kD. Positive control: Mouse LRP5-pSEC-tag-transfected 293T cells, MCF-7 human breast adenocarcinoma, T47D human breast ductal carcinoma, and NIH-3T3 mouse embryo fibroblast lysates. -
